Pacers Receive Disabled Player Exception

Last updated on Thursday, August 14, 2014

(INDIANAPOLIS) - The Pacers have been awarded a disabled player exception worth more than $5 million due to the leg injury Paul George suffered nearly two weeks ago.

The Pacers are not expected to use any more than $1.6 million of the exception on any player, because they aren't willing to pay the luxury tax.

The exception does not guarantee that George won't play this season, but means that doctors believe it's more likely than not that the superstar will miss all year.
